About PIZZA DOUGH
PIZZA DOUGH is a moderate-calorie food with 228 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is carbohydrates, providing 8.8g of protein, 45.6g of carbohydrates, and 1.8g of fat. It also contributes 1.8g of dietary fiber per serving. This food belongs to the Crusts & Dough category.
Ingredients
ENRICHED FLOUR (WHEAT FLOUR, NIACIN, REDUCED IRON, THIAMINE MONONITRATE, RIBOFLAVIN, FOLIC ACID), MALTED BARLEY FLOUR, FILTERED WATER, CANE SUGAR, SALT, ORGANIC SOYBEAN OIL, INSTANT YEAST (YEAST (SACCHAROMYCES CEREVISIAE), SORBITAN MONOSTEARATE, ASCORBIC ACID)
